a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java
diff options
context:
space:
mode:
authorGravatar cparsons <cparsons@google.com>2018-03-22 09:07:25 -0700
committerGravatar Copybara-Service <copybara-piper@google.com>2018-03-22 09:09:18 -0700
commit2c81467ba10ffa05fa5e2f06a47cc4d5241f195b (patch)
tree4d78aae305a1514b6ff7487ad7f829fbb53dc95d /src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java
parent3e9c776167b06fb7ff1e6b92de202548cb35c00a (diff)
Convert SkylarkActionFactory methods to use @SkylarkCallable instead of @SkylarkSignature
RELNOTES: None. PiperOrigin-RevId: 190073508
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java')
-rw-r--r--src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java b/src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java
index dab37d82cb..6e04c6170d 100644
--- a/src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java
+++ b/src/main/java/com/google/devtools/build/lib/runtime/BlazeRuntime.java
@@ -30,7 +30,6 @@ import com.google.devtools.build.lib.analysis.ConfiguredRuleClassProvider;
import com.google.devtools.build.lib.analysis.ServerDirectories;
import com.google.devtools.build.lib.analysis.config.BuildOptions;
import com.google.devtools.build.lib.analysis.config.ConfigurationFragmentFactory;
-import com.google.devtools.build.lib.analysis.skylark.SkylarkActionFactory;
import com.google.devtools.build.lib.analysis.test.CoverageReportActionFactory;
import com.google.devtools.build.lib.buildeventstream.PathConverter;
import com.google.devtools.build.lib.buildtool.BuildRequestOptions;
@@ -1110,7 +1109,8 @@ public final class BlazeRuntime {
* frozen at all for them. They just pay the cost of extra synchronization on every access.
*/
private static void initSkylarkBuiltinsRegistry() {
- SkylarkActionFactory.forceStaticInitialization();
+ // Currently no classes need to be initialized here. The hook's still here because it's
+ // possible it may be needed again in the future.
com.google.devtools.build.lib.syntax.Runtime.getBuiltinRegistry().freeze();
}